Transaction 8517cec7b4dd9a2d2d9aeb37fce69f02148f9ad052e8a16685279d19f997dd22
1 Input
1 Outputs
- 8517cec7b4dd9a2d2d9aeb37fce69f02148f9ad052e8a16685279d19f997dd22:0
value 231052
address 3H5qgKDUnANRi6bFqjQdeoxVmrEn3PaZzp